PUMP TYPES 

 Single-Acting Pumps 8 ma9es only one suctionand disc#arge stro9e for one completereciprocating cycle.

 Double-Acting Pumps 8 ma9es t+o suction anddisc#arge stro9es for one complete reciprocatingcycle. 

 Reciprocating Pumps

PUMP TYPES 

 Reciprocating Pumps

  Direct-Acting Pumps 8 #as a plunger on t#e li6uid end t#atis directly driven by t#e pump rod.

 

 Indirect-Acting Pumps 8 driven by means of a beam orlin9age connected to and actuated by t#e po+er piston rodof a separate reciprocating engine.

PUMP & HEAD TERMINOLOGY 

%luid +ead ,erminolog!

Pressure $ead, # p  P/ρ, is Pressure nergy

levation $ead, #e  C, is Potential nergy

(elocity $ead, #v  (2/2g, is Einetic nergy

Pump $ead,  p is increase in fluid energy from pump +or9

MATERIALS OF CONSTRUCTION 

Must be capable of being fabricated into t#e form desired.

Must be able to +it#stand t#e stresses imposed by t#eintended service.

Must be resistant to t#e corrosion-erosion imposed by t#esystem.

Must be commercially available and economical to use.
